Output 95afcac87721950f3edaff15da824a028eb4e3d9fd466957cb9f49e1c72bfeee:2

value
25000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43fc3cc7bca4951644f88bcf262396d6924a751f OP_EQUAL
address
37tVNADiyHWjHCd8PWWcdvSyo7h3hSqD1r
transaction
95afcac87721950f3edaff15da824a028eb4e3d9fd466957cb9f49e1c72bfeee
spent
true